every day, coins from all over the world find their way into our donation boxes, which makes us very happy! Many of these coins are of small denomination. However, all of them have to be sorted and counted by hand before being taken to the bank – which then charges a fee for depositing them...
As we know that the banks charge again when they return the coins, we came up with the idea of simply skipping this ‘intermediate step’.
Instead, we would now like to use this method to return these coins to their countries of circulation (or make them available to numismatists) and, at the same time, generate donations equivalent to their value, which we will then – in accordance with our statutes – use in full for the benefit of the German Museum of Technology in Berlin.
If you are planning to travel to one of the countries listed here with currently valid coins, please contact us so that we can – where possible – exchange your euros for foreign coins.
